About Konstantin Reinfeld

At a young age Konstantin Reinfeld already causes a sensation in the music world. Having been proclaimed as a wunderkind since his first years of playing, harmonicist Konstantin Reinfeld got one of the most respected players and instructors in the world during the few years he has been playing the instrument. His chromatic playing on diatonic Hohner harmonicas sounds technically and emotionally mature.
With his first live appearance during the Frankfurt Music Fair in 2010 Reinfeld, now 21 years old, made a huge impact and left an equally gigantic impression. At the invitation of the internationally renowned blues harmonica player Steve Baker he joined the “Harmonica Masters Workshops 2010” in Trossingen as a scholar and was discovered by Hohner getting the youngest member of their endorser program. After the autodidactic work his love to jazz led him to study at the “Howard Levy Harmonica School” and with Howard Levy himself.
In summer 2012 and still in high school Reinfeld recorded his first and highly respected CD "Mr. Quilento“ in the legendary Peer Studios in Hamburg presenting his first original compositions. In 2013 the LP was published under the brand „Hohner Masters Of The Harmonica“, distributed through Membran/Sonymusic.
Reinfeld recorded his second full length LP with his band “Mr. Quilento“ in the Peer Studios that was released in November 2015. With these recordings he shows that his own compositions eclipse every boarder between genres and can not be classified into a specific category. With that he explores new territories - not only musically concerning his diatonic instrument but also stylistically.
Since the recordings of his debut album Konstantin is one of the most popular harmonica players worldwide and gives concerts on the most important stages in jazz.
As a soloist and lecturer he is moreover on the road for national and international harmonica festivals (World Harmonica Festival, Seoul International Harmonica Festival, Bristol NHL Festival, Pärnu Harmonica Festival, Harmonica Bridge Festival Torun etc.) and was advertised as of the best players in the world on the 10-hole instrument at the World Harmonica Festival 2013.
Right now he is working on two duo projects. For one thing he is recording an album full of jazz standards with Christoph Spangenberg in honor of Toots Thielemans, for another thing he is presenting the unimagined possibilities of the harmonica in classical and film music with Benyamin Nuss.
